About Your Trip

Captain Nick has always been passionate about the water and is dedicated to creating an awesome fishing experience for both seasoned and novice anglers alike.
Your vessel for the day will be a spacious 34 ft’ Contender center console. She’s perfectly suited for 6 anglers, who can all fish at the same time, and is powered by twin 250 HP Yamaha engines that’ll have you zipping to all the best spots in no time.
We
fish some of the most prominent artificial and natural reefs in Volusia county on Florida’s productive east coast. Here you’ll find plenty of Snapper, Amberjack, and Barracuda. Opt to stay closer to shore and you’ll fill up that cooler with tasty Redfish, Sheepshead, and Black Drum!


What to bring
All of your fishing gear, as well as snorkeling masks, will be waiting for you on board. You’re also free to bring along your own spearfishing equipment if you’re experienced. All you’ll need is your own drinks and snacks, we provide the cooler!

Each trip’s price is set by the guide and factors in all of their costs. A big determinant of cost is often the type of boat and associated fuel costs, but other guide costs include leases, marina / slip fees, bait costs, and the cost to provide and maintain all of the gear you’ll need on your trip.
